Papillary thyroid carcinoma frequently metastasizes to regional lymph nodes. However, cervical lymph node metastasis as a sole manifestation of occult papillary thyroid carcinoma is rarely observed. Ectopic thyroid is an uncommon condition defined as the presence of thyroid tissue at a site other than pretracheal area. Approximately 1–3% of all ectopic thyroid tissue is located in the lateral neck. This entity may represent the only functional thyroid tissue in the body. Malignant transformation of ectopic thyroid is uncommon; but even rarer is the development of papillary carcinoma on it. We present a case of a 33-year-old man with an incidental lateral neck mass diagnosed after a motor vehicle accident. Total thyroidectomy and lymph node resection were completed without evidence of papillary thyroid carcinoma. Malignant transformation of heterotopic thyroid tissue was the final diagnosis. The possibility of an ectopic thyroid cancer should be considered in the differential diagnosis of a pathological mass in the neck. The uniqueness of this case strives in the rarity that the thyroid gland was free of malignancy, despite ectopic tissue being positive for thyroid carcinoma. Management strategies, including performance of total thyroidectomy, neck dissection, and treatment with radioiodine, should be based on individualized risk assessment.

Papillary thyroid carcinoma is the most common thyroid malignancy and frequently metastasizes to regional lymph nodes. Occasionally, metastatic lymph nodes are palpable without the evidence of primary tumour. Papillary thyroid carcinoma of lateral neck cyst is a rare condition. It may arise from thyroid primary which underwent cystic degeneration or true malignant transformation of ectopic thyroid tissue. Herein, we reported two cases with preoperative diagnosis of benign lateral neck cyst but postoperative histopathological results showed primary papillary thyroid carcinoma. Ultrasonography and computed tomography of the neck in both cases showed no significant thyroid lesion. However, the patient in Case  2 was subjected for total thyroidectomy and histopathological results showed the origin of primary tumour. In conclusion, thorough investigations including total thyroidectomy are indicated in cases of papillary thyroid carcinoma of lateral neck cyst. This practice is to ensure that this type of thyroid cancer can be detected earlier because it has a very good prognosis if treated earlier.

AbstractObjective:To review the diagnosis of primary papillary carcinoma of ectopic thyroid tissue within branchial cleft cysts, and to discuss the diagnostic challenge of differentiating this condition from metastatic disease when an occult microcarcinoma is found in the thyroid gland.Methods:These comprise a case report and a literature review. We present the case of a 75-year-old woman with papillary thyroid carcinoma within the wall of a recurrent, 15 cm, lateral neck cyst.Results:Histological examination of the patient's thyroid gland found a 0.5 mm papillary thyroid microcarcinoma.Conclusion:Our differential diagnosis was primary papillary carcinoma arising from ectopic thyroid tissue, or metastatic cystic degeneration of a lateral lymph node. We make an argument for the former.

We report a rare case of papillary thyroid carcinoma incidentally found within a branchial cleft cyst. Only four other cases have been described in the literature. A total thyroidectomy and selective neck dissection was performed, and no evidence of occult primary disease was found after review of fine sections. Branchial cleft cysts are the most common lateral neck masses. Ectopic thyroid tissue within a branchial cleft cyst is an unusual phenomenon, and papillary thyroid carcinoma arising from this tissue is extremely rare. Clinicians are left with a diagnostic dilemma when presented with thyroid tissue neoplasm within a neck cyst in the absence of a thyroid primary—is this a case of metastatic disease with a missed primary or rather carcinoma arising in ectopic thyroid tissue? A thorough discussion of the etiologies of these lateral neck masses is reviewed including the embryogenesis of thyroid tissue in a branchial cleft cyst. The prognosis of patients with papillary thyroid carcinoma in lateral neck cysts without a primary site identified appears to be good following excision of the cyst and total thyroidectomy. Other management recommendations regarding these unique lateral neck malignancies are also presented.

Ectopic thyroid tissue is ubiquitous in the body, most frequently seen at the base of tongue, accounting for approximately 95% of reported cases. Branchial cleft cyst, a congenital abnormality, can occasionally harbor thyroid tissue inside the cyst. These ectopic thyroid tissues can develop the same disease as the orthodox thyroid gland, including the malignant diseases. Papillary thyroid carcinoma arising in the branchial cleft cyst was extremely rare, total of only 14 cases were reported in the literature. Herein, I report additional case which was discovered incidentally after surgery.

Abstract Background Thyroid swellings enlarge caudally into the mediastinum behind the sternum. Pre-sternal swelling of thyroid origin is very rare. We present our case of pre-sternal thyroid swelling which was albeit a surprisingly rare site of papillary thyroid carcinoma recurrence and review of pre-sternal thyroid swellings reported till date. Case summary A 60 year old female presented with a painless, progressive swelling on the anterior part of the chest for the past 2 years. A 15 cm × 8 cm vertically aligned, non tender, well defined swelling was present on the pre-sternal region, with consistency ranging from soft to firm. The swelling was fixed to the underlying tissues and a fixed level IV lymph node was palpable on the right side. Ultrasonography revealed a large mass of 15 × 7 cm with multiple cystic areas. Fine needle aspiration cytology was inconclusive twice. Patient had undergone a total thyroidectomy for papillary carcinoma 10 years back. Computed tomography findings revealed a large 15 × 6.6 × 7 cm lobulated, pre-sternal, soft tissue lesion with solid & cystic components. The mass was infiltrating the right sided strap muscles and sternocleidomastoid. FNAC was inconclusive and thyroid scan could not pick up any activity in the mass. Henceforth a PET scan was done that showed increased FDG uptake by the lesion and the level IV lymph node. The patient underwent wide excision of the mass with right functional neck dissection, along with removal with both sternal head of sternocleido-mastoid, the strap muscles and the surrounding fascia. Histopathology confirmed papillary thyroid carcinoma. Patient received post-operative radioactive iodine ablation and is healthy with no recurrence up to 30 months of follow up. Discussion The mechanisms for pre-sternal thyroid swelling are not understood due to paucity of cases. The mechanisms proposed are invasion of strap muscles and cervical linea alba and tumor cells spread anterior to sternum, truly ectopic thyroid tissue, de novo carcinogenesis in the embryonal remnants like the thyro-thymic residues, sequestered thyroid tissue which grows later or migration of thyroid cells, incomplete clearance at the time of primary surgery or intraoperative seeding. Conclusion Pre-sternal region masses of thyroid origin are very rare. A proper work up, suspicion for thyroid mass and array of tests will be required to come to a provisional diagnosis. Since the masses reported in literature were primarily malignant, any such mass may be treated on lines of malignancy with radical surgery.

Herein, we report a case of an occult thyroid cancer that was not detected as a primary tumor on preoperative ultrasonography or postoperative pathological examination, although a diagnosis of papillary thyroid carcinoma metastasis was made owing to the presence of a mass in the right upper neck. Needle biopsy of the mass in the right upper neck revealed positive results for thyroglobulin and TTF-1 on immunostaining, and a papillary thyroid carcinoma was observed with papillary and follicular patterns. We suspected papillary thyroid carcinoma (T0N1bM0) or ectopic papillary thyroid carcinoma. Accordingly, we performed total thyroidectomy, central lymph node dissection, right lateral neck dissection, and resection of the superficial lobe of the right parotid. A postoperative pathological examination of 5-mm slices of the specimen revealed no primary tumor in the thyroid. However, a hyalinized image of the thyroid indicated that a micropapillary thyroid carcinoma might have spontaneously disappeared. As there was no normal thyroid tissue in the metastasis to the superior internal jugular lymph node, the tumor was unlikely to be an ectopic papillary thyroid carcinoma. Therefore, we made a diagnosis of a papillary thyroid carcinoma (pT0N1bM0). After surgery, we determined that the tumor belonged to a high-risk group of papillary thyroid carcinomas and a poor-prognosis group of symptomatic papillary thyroid microcarcinomas; accordingly, ablation was performed with 30 mCi iodine-131. There was no recurrence or metastasis 24 months after the first surgery.
